Indigenous clothing in the Philippines includes woven fabrics like the “T’nalak” of the T’boli tribe and the “Inabel” of the Ilocano people. Traditional shelter varies by region, with examples like the “bahay kubo” or nipa hut made of bamboo and cogon grass, and the stilt houses of the Badjao sea gypsies. These structures showcase the resourcefulness and adaptability of indigenous communities in the Philippines.

There are currently 110 recognized indigenous cultural communities or tribes in the Philippines. Each tribal group has its own unique language, customs, and traditions that contribute to the rich cultural diversity of the country.
The traditional clothing of the Igorot people from the Philippines includes woven cotton jackets, loincloths for men, and wrap-around skirts for women. Their traditional dwellings are known as "houses on stilts" made of bamboo and cogon grass, raised off the ground to protect against floods and wild animals.
The Subanon are an indigenous group in the Philippines, primarily found in the Zamboanga Peninsula on the island of Mindanao. They are known for their unique culture, traditional beliefs, and handicrafts.

The Bajau people are a sea-faring nomadic ethnic group found in Southeast Asia. Known for their exceptional free-diving abilities, the Bajau traditionally live in houseboats or stilt houses built on the water and rely on fishing and trading for their livelihood.
